Output 89dd4f4a7889ea940c5a3f525b27a0cc5cf1817057479820d6d8328099ac76fa:1

value
28620631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d444715e2276eaa6cb4753c4145d9e21f92ded16 OP_EQUAL
address
3M3PAhn6iufL16333QFMd2dT2RRM7fATnp
transaction
89dd4f4a7889ea940c5a3f525b27a0cc5cf1817057479820d6d8328099ac76fa
spent
true